Spicy Summer Fruit Salad

The combination of jalapeno pepper and cool mint turn fresh berries and stone fruit into a tangy-sweet summer salad you won’t forget. If you’re short on time, feel free to use 1/2 cup pre-made raspberry jam instead of making your own.

Ingredients
- 1 Package (6 ounces) Driscoll's Raspberries
- 1/2 Cup sugar
- Zest of half a medium lemon
- Juice of half a medium lemon
- 1/8 Tsp. salt
- 1 Package (16 ounces) Driscoll's Strawberries
- 2 Packages (6 ounces each) Driscoll's Blueberries
- 1 Package (6 ounces) Driscoll's Raspberries
- 1 Package (6 ounces) Driscoll's Blackberries
- 2 medium peaches
- 2 medium plums
- 1 medium jalapeño pepper
- 1 Tbsp. sugar
- 2 Tablespoons fresh lime juice
- 2 Tablespoons fresh mint, chopped
Directions
- PLACE 1 package raspberries into a small saucepan.
- ADD 1/2 cup sugar.
- ADD zest of half a medium lemon.
- ADD juice of half a medium lemon.
- ADD 1/8 teaspoon salt.
- STIR to combine.
- BRING to a boil over high heat.
- REDUCE heat to medium and SIMMER about 35 minutes until thickened and reduced by half and STIR more frequently toward end of cook time to prevent burning on bottom.
- ALLOW jam to cool to room temperature before using.
- HULL 1 package strawberries.
- SLICE smaller strawberries in quarters and SLICE larger strawberries in sixths and PLACE strawberry slices into a large bowl.
- ADD 2 packages blueberries and ADD 1 package raspberries and ADD 1 package blackberries.
- PIT and SLICE 2 medium peaches and ADD peach slices to bowl.
- PIT and SLICE 2 medium plums and ADD plum slices to bowl.
- SEED and CHOP 1 medium jalapeno pepper and ADD to bowl to taste depending on your preference for heat.
- SPRINKLE 1 tablespoon sugar over mixture and TOSS gently to combine.
- SET ASIDE berry mixture.
- ADD 3 tablespoons fresh lime juice to cooled jam.
- ADD 2 tablespoons fresh mint to cooled jam.
- STIR until smooth.
- POUR jam mixture over berry mixture and TOSS gently to combine.
- LET STAND at room temperature 20 minutes before serving.
